Abstract

A network terminal is capable of running a plurality of user environments in parallel and is connected to an interface device. The network terminal includes a plurality of communication units, a plurality of collaborating units, and a monitoring unit. The plurality of communication units are provided in one to one correspondence with a plurality of user environments. Each communication unit is configured to implement an Internet Protocol telephone call in the corresponding user environment. The plurality of collaborating units are provided in one to one correspondence with the plurality of communication units. Each collaborating unit is configured to perform a collaborative control on the corresponding communication unit and the interface device to thereby establish communications between the interface device and the corresponding communication unit. The monitoring unit monitors whether any of the collaborating units is performing the collaborative control. One of the plurality of collaborating units performs the collaborative control when the subject collaborating unit receives: notification from the monitoring unit indicating that none of the plurality of collaborating units is performing a collaborative control; and notification from the interface device specifying the subject collaborating unit as a specified collaborating unit to perform the collaborating control.
